Vienna:  Qatar Beach Volleyball Team of Cherif Younousse and Jefferson Pereira defeated Germany’s Bockermann and Fluggen 2-0 in their first appearance at the World Beach Volleyball Championship which began on Friday in Vienna.
Pereira and Younousse were too good for the Germans duo who emerged champions of the Olsztyn International Beach Tour, which was recently held in Poland.
The Qatari duo overcame the German team by 21-19 in the first set and 21-15 in the second set.
The draw put Qatar in Group B with Latvia, Germany, and Venezuela.
The Qatari team qualified for the World Championships for the second time in the history after being crowned the champions of the Asian Beach Volleyball Championship (Qatar Masters), which was held in Doha in May.
They beat  Australia 2-1 in the final which took place at the Aspire Zone who also hosted all the tournament which was organised by the Qatar Football Federation with the participation of 24 teams representing 13 countries.
